Freelance Test & Commissioning Engineers (Video)Reports toHead of OperationsDepartmentOperationsLocationAt sites both nationally, internationally and on occasion at The Rickyard, Eashing Lane, Godalming, Surrey, GU7 2QA, United Kingdom. Hours of Work9:00 – 5:30 Monday to Friday and as required to fulfil dutiesKey Relationships (External)Installation and Service ClientsKey Relationships (Internal)Production Engineering, Operations Team (incl. Service and Projects)Main Purpose of JobThe Test and Commissioning Engineer – Video is a member of the Operations Team, providing contracted testing and commissioning as directed by the Sysco Project and Operations Team. The primary focus is to meet client testing and commissioning needs as specified by Sysco Design and Production Engineers. Key Responsibilites To plan and undertake testing and commissioning of audio/visual systems both within the Sysco workshop and on client sites to ensure their compliance with Production Engineering documentation. On larger or more complex projects, to work under the supervision of the Project Manager, agreeing work schedules and approach and keeping them informed of progress. To ensure that the Site Manager and/or Project Manager are kept informed of commissioning progress and any issues that may require their support or intervention. To liaise with external media agencies to ensure their media is delivered in agreed and appropriate formats for the playback hardware. To create, maintain and issue the final IP Matrix for projects so that the Production Engineer can create accurate O&M documentation. To create, maintain and issue the final Media Matrix for projects so that the Production Engineer can create accurate O&M documentation. To assist the Service Team in closing open fault cases on external client sites. Person Specification (Experience / Qualifications) Strong experience in set-up, testing, fault finding and installation of AV equipment. Strong technical knowledge of AV systems gained within a similar industry is desirable. Organised and flexible, confident approaching different tasks to meet tight deadlines. An experienced technical engineer with experience of networks and audio/visual systems. Experience of configuring and installing AV video systems, including expert knowledge of one or more of the following: Brightsign, 7th Sense, Watchout, D3, Blades, Interactive PCs, Projectors. Experience of using Adobe Creative Suite. CSCS/ECS card holder as minimum. Experienced in working to high standards and possessing strong attention to detail. Experience of working with minimal supervision and on own initiative. Full UK driving license with no previous or current driving bans. CITB Health, Safety and Environment Test. CSCS card holder.
